That's all I have right now from reputable sources (that I have handy). I'm sure a simple google search will turn up a lot more (although there is a ton of pseudo science as well).
I appreciate the separation of reputable from pseudo. I did a search, but a disproportionate amount of the content was fluff and pseudo, and I don't really have the expertise to tell quickly between the closer cases.